What are some typical daily responsibilities of a Gravure Printing Operator?

As a Gravure Printing Operator, your daily tasks include setting up and maintaining gravure presses, preparing ink and materials, and performing regular quality checks on print runs. You will monitor machine performance, troubleshoot technical issues, and ensure production deadlines are met safely and efficiently. Collaboration with other press operators, quality assurance teams, and maintenance staff is a key part of the role. The work environment is often fast-paced, requiring strong attention to detail and adaptability as print jobs and priorities shift throughout the day.

What is a Gravure job?

A Gravure job typically involves operating and maintaining rotogravure printing presses, which are used for high-volume printing of packaging, magazines, and labels. Responsibilities may include setting up the press, monitoring ink levels, ensuring print quality, and performing routine maintenance. Workers in this role need attention to detail, mechanical skills, and an understanding of printing processes.

Quad is currently searching for a RotoGravure Imaging Technical Lead for our Lomira, WI location. The purpose of this job is to support Gravure Imaging equipment uptime, best practices, and related consumable usage/supply chain management while maintaining customer quality and delivery expectations.
This includes gravure cylinder equipment used for;
  • Cylinder Base repair
  • Ballard shell removal
  • Electromechanical engraving
  • Copper and Chrome Electro-plating lines
  • All cylinder transport/storage equipment
  • Cylinder and parts cleaning equipment.
